When dicoumarol is ingested by animals, it prevents the formation of vitamin K. Blood clotting requires vitamin K as part of the process. Yuca, a starchy, edible tuber, belongs to the cassava family, while yucca is a broad genus of plants belonging to the Asparagaceae family.
